Involvement in the occult is a major open door for evil spirits to gain access into people’s lives. The word occult means “secret” or “hidden” and refers in a general sense to the supernatural realm of Satan. It speaks of secret knowledge into the spirit world, gained through ungodly and illegitimate means. The occult is a broad term that refers to the various activities, groups, and practices that seek knowledge, influence, and power through the spiritual realm outside of the one true living God. There is only one safe way to enter into the supernatural: a relationship with God through Jesus Christ, by the power of the Holy Spirit. Anything outside of this is crossing into spiritual territory that involves demonic deception and influence.
Satan lures people into the occult through deceptive tactics. He makes it look very appealing and attractive; but it always comes with a high price. Some enter into the occult because they have been wounded, and they seek the sense of control or power that is promised. Others are drawn out of mere curiosity or a misguided spiritual hunger for otherworldly things. Some people are born into families that are practitioners of the occult, giving evil spirits access to their lives at a young age. Some are in rebellion and are looking for darkness, while others are actually seeking to do good, but do not know that they are entering into a dark realm. Whether people realize it or not, they are interacting with and welcoming evil spirits into their lives. I have seen time and again how demons have entered into people through experimenting with or delving into occult activities. When they renounced the occult involvement, the demons were cast out and they were set free.

Any involvement in occult practices is strictly forbidden in Scripture. The occult has many branches, and Deuteronomy 18:9-12 is a passage that outlines various types of activities that fall into this category:
When you come into the land which the Lord your God is giving you, you shall not learn to follow the abominations of those nations. There shall not be found among you anyone who makes his son or his daughter pass through the fire, or one who practices witchcraft, or a soothsayer, or one who interprets omens, or a sorcerer, or one who conjures spells, or a medium, or a spiritist, or one who calls up the dead. For all who do these things are an abomination to the Lord, and because of these abominations the Lord your God drives them out from before you.

When it comes to satanism, the occult, and secret societies, there is often a sanitized version that gets portrayed publicly. But the deeper you get, the darker it becomes. Some occult groups are involved in crime, obscene rituals, sexual abuse and perversion, and animal or even human sacrifices. The devil loves to lure people in, only to reveal his true nature and intentions once it is too late and his grip is firmly entrenched.
The occult is nothing to play around with. Even those who merely dabble in these areas are literally inviting demons to come into their lives. Some people think it is a game to see a fortuneteller or palm reader, or to play with a Ouija board. Some like to read their horoscopes and get insight from psychics. Some think that having séances or trying to communicate with the dead is harmless. Some read occult-themed books, watch spiritually dark movies, or play video games that contain occult activities. Evil spirits see these things as an open door for them to enter in and bring oppression and torment. The devil doesn’t care if you did it “just for fun.” He seeks any opportunity to steal, kill, and destroy. And the more involved you become in the occult, the greater the demonic bondage becomes.
